Bright Matter, a specialist learning-sector recruitment consultancy, is to exhibit at the upcoming CIPD Learning and Development Show and will be providing recruitment and careers guidance for L&D employers and employees.

The annual CIPD Learning and Development Show is taking place in London next week. Bright Matter will be exhibiting at the event and its team will be on hand to meet with employers and candidates.

Bright Matter is a specialist recruiter serving the L&D and learning technology sector. It recruits learning leaders, learning and development managers, instructional designers, digital learning developers, learning technologists, digital learning creatives, learning programme managers, learning project managers, learning business developers and learning marketers.

It’s founder, Marie Faulkner, has a wealth of expertise in recruiting learning technology roles: “Technology and learning are evolving at a tremendous pace and there is a high demand for digital learning professionals who are able to help businesses adapt. We’re looking forward to meeting employers and employees, sharing our knowledge and listening to and learning from the learning community.”

At the show Bright Matter will publish the first of a series of careers guides for learning and development professionals, providing in-depth information about employment as a digital learning developer.

The CIPD Learning and Development Show takes place on 10, 11 May at the Olympia exhibition venue in London. It comprises of a conference themed around helping people to build a learning-centred culture within their organisation and an exhibition of many commercial learning providers and learning services businesses.
